GCN Circular 14659

Subject
GRB 130514B Swift-BAT observations

J. R. Cummings (UMBC/CRESST/GSFC) and H. A. Krimm (USRA/CRESST/NASA)
report on behalf of the Swift-BAT team:

At the time of the INTEGRAL GRB 130514B (Mereghetti et al. GCN Circ# 14638),
Swift was in a preplanned slew maneuver.  BAT photon event data was
collected during this slew.  BAT saves such "slew survey" data when possible
within telemetry constraints.  The source was detected in a mosaic image.
As seen in BAT, the burst was a single FRED peak about 7 +/- 1 seconds long.
The source had about 10% mask coding in the BAT detector plane.

The BAT spectrum is well-fit by a power-law function with a photon index
of 1.72 +/- 0.21.  The fluence from 15-150 keV in 8 seconds was
(8.8 +/- 0.6) x 10^-7 ergs/cm^2/sec.  Errors are 68% confidence.
